      @djabthrash 7 หลายเดือนก่อน

      Have you tried simply raising the incoming signal level just before hitting the ampsim ?

    • @belligerentamateur
      @belligerentamateur  7 หลายเดือนก่อน

      @@djabthrash if you mean the gain on the interface, I always aim for -12 peak input gain because that's where I feel most plugins sound and react closest to real amps. But there is an input level control on the plugin that allows you to raise the input sig ak, and I've done so as high as I can. without it clipping, and it's still just not even close to enough for most models. These models were mostly captured with very little gain, so it's difficult or nearly impossible to get them into high Gain territory without some serious trickery.

    • @djabthrash
      @djabthrash 7 หลายเดือนก่อน

      @@belligerentamateur You can still add gain inside the plugin, just before the amp block, by adding an effect set transparently with just its output volume adjusted (ex : compressor with ratio at 1:0 but output gain raised).
      In the Two Notes Torpedo Torpedo Genome plugin, I'd insert a volume pedal block before my amp and add some gain with the volume pedal. I can also raise the output volume of any block element i insert before the amp block. Maybe you can do something similar in your guitar plugin suite (without having to adjust the plugin input level).

    • @eds4754
      @eds4754 7 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      @@DerSilvano IMO the differences are a bit over exaggerated online. Main influence on the tone is the master volume, different versions use different tapers so eyeballing settings will lead to different tones. Same goes for the bass knob, some versions you have to set those controls very different.
      3 channel ones handle some stuff different to how the 2 channel does channel cloning stuff, those modes are hardest to match on the newer recto’s.
